diff --git a/.gitignore b/.gitignore index 5360ddc..93a8e3f 100644 --- a/.gitignore +++ b/.gitignore @@ -5,3 +5,4 @@ d-feet-0.1.12.tar.bz2 /d-feet-0.1.15.tar.xz /d-feet-0.3.1.tar.xz /d-feet-0.3.3.tar.xz +/d-feet-0.3.4.tar.xz diff --git a/d-feet.spec b/d-feet.spec index c0296ba..1978593 100644 --- a/d-feet.spec +++ b/d-feet.spec @@ -1,6 +1,6 @@ Name: d-feet -Version: 0.3.3 -Release: 2%{?dist} +Version: 0.3.4 +Release: 1%{?dist} Summary: A powerful D-Bus Debugger Group: Development/Tools License: GPLv2+ @@ -9,8 +9,12 @@ Source0: http://download.gnome.org/sources/d-feet/0.3/d-feet-%{version}.tar.xz BuildArch: noarch BuildRequires: desktop-file-utils -BuildRequires: python-setuptools BuildRequires: gettext +BuildRequires: glib2-devel +BuildRequires: gtk3-devel +BuildRequires: intltool +BuildRequires: itstool +BuildRequires: python-pep8 Requires: pygobject3 %description @@ -23,12 +27,16 @@ D-Bus objects of running programs and invoke methods on those objects. %setup -q %build -%{__python} setup.py build +%configure +make %{?_smp_mflags} %install -%{__python} setup.py install --skip-build --root %{buildroot} +make install DESTDIR=%{buildroot} -desktop-file-validate %{buildroot}%{_datadir}/applications/dfeet.desktop +%find_lang d-feet --with-gnome + +%check +desktop-file-validate %{buildroot}%{_datadir}/applications/d-feet.desktop %post touch --no-create %{_datadir}/icons/hicolor &>/dev/null || : @@ -42,17 +50,22 @@ fi %posttrans gtk-update-icon-cache %{_datadir}/icons/hicolor &>/dev/null || : -%files +%files -f d-feet.lang %doc AUTHORS COPYING README NEWS %{python_sitelib}/dfeet/ -%{python_sitelib}/d_feet*.egg-info %{_bindir}/d-feet -%{_datadir}/dfeet/ +%{_datadir}/applications/d-feet.desktop +%{_datadir}/d-feet/ +%{_datadir}/glib-2.0/schemas/org.gnome.d-feet.gschema.xml %{_datadir}/icons/hicolor/*/apps/*.png %{_datadir}/icons/hicolor/scalable/apps/d-feet.svg -%{_datadir}/applications/dfeet.desktop +%{_datadir}/icons/HighContrast/scalable/apps/d-feet.svg %changelog +* Sat May 25 2013 Kalev Lember - 0.3.4-1 +- Update to 0.3.4 +- Switch to the autotools build + * Wed Feb 13 2013 Fedora Release Engineering - 0.3.3-2 - Rebuilt for https://fedoraproject.org/wiki/Fedora_19_Mass_Rebuild diff --git a/sources b/sources index 444d4a0..6a8bc65 100644 --- a/sources +++ b/sources @@ -1 +1 @@ -164b7803f7424b5db4cda070ed844360 d-feet-0.3.3.tar.xz +ca9ba39964c6f3f8d98666c2ed938b52 d-feet-0.3.4.tar.xz